Transaction 8743841591cd37ab2038c25119e644221e803a77d8f27ba707b02077b533cf43

2 Input
2 Outputs
  • 8743841591cd37ab2038c25119e644221e803a77d8f27ba707b02077b533cf43:0
  • value  1046586
    address  333dv3Zg3mqiyhgsmwsLcZw4VzhRTieQFQ
  • 8743841591cd37ab2038c25119e644221e803a77d8f27ba707b02077b533cf43:1
  • value  5062927
    address  1Fo34B4kQjV7RrvQFAJPcdYNhfiHg5nYAR